Flammability
Administrative data
Link to relevant study record(s)
Description of key information
MEXORYL SCK was NOT considered as a flammable solid under the experimental conditions used, according to Regulation (EC) 1272/2008 (CLP Regulation)
Key value for chemical safety assessment
- Flammability:
- non flammable
Additional information
A GLP study was performed in order to estimate the flammability property of MEXORYL SCK (also called MEXORYL SBT) in compliance with the EU methods A.10.
An attempt was made to ignite the sample with the aim to determine the burning time over a distance of 200 mm, if applicable.
In contact with the flame of a gas burner (contact time of about 2 minutes) MEXORYL SBT burned and turned black and carbonized. Without the ignition source the flame extinguished. As MEXORYL SCK could not be ignited with a flame during the preliminary test, no main test was performed and the test substance is considered as not highly flammable.
The study was conducted according to an internationally recognised method, and under GLP. The substance is considered to be adequately characterised. Therefore full validation applies.
Regarding the studies related to the determination of flammability in contact with water and of pyrophoric properties and in accordance with section 1 of REACh Annex XI, these stuides are deemed unnecessary based on the experience in handling and use of the substance.
Considering that the experience in handling and use of MEXORYL SCK confirms the lack of hazard, the test A12 (Flammability on contact with water) and the test A13 (Pyrophoric properties of solids and liquids) were not conducted.
Justification for classification or non-classification
As MEXORYL SCK could not be ignited with a flame during the preliminary test, no main test was performed and the test substance is considered as not highly flammable.
Note : In accordance with section 1 of REACH Annex XI, studies for flammability on contact with water and for pyrophoric properties are deemed unnecessary based on the experience in handling and use of the substance. Therefore, the test A12 (Flammability on contact with water) and the test A13 (Pyrophoric properties of solids and liquids) were not conducted.
